Both Glen and I have had to buy genuine Kawasaki spares in the past couple of weeks.
Mine was $250 for a sump/oil pan for my 08 ZX6R, Glen/Chris's gear lever was $170 for their 08 ZX6R (didn't even come with the rubber boot) and these were the prices after our KSRC discount.
Just for fun, that got us thinking what would it cost to build a modern bike entirely from genuine kawasaki spares?
I'll chuck out there $40,000.

Its still a matter of degrees. It would be cheaper to buy an engine as a whole than to buy each component part, so is your hypothetical spares bike to be built from units or broken down to the smallest components in the parts manual? I remember a story about 'some guy' who built a car from spares and the cost was astronomical. Remember also that the manufacturers often claim that they don't make money on the original vehicle - and thats why parts cost so much.
